Step 1: Assessment and Containment
Our team will arrive at your home and assess the situation, identifying the source of the water damage and containing the affected area to prevent further complications. We’ll use specialized equipment to detect moisture levels and prevent further damage. This step is crucial in preventing further damage and ensuring a successful restoration process.
Step 2: Water Extraction
Once the area is contained, our team will use specialized equipment to extract the standing water from your home. We’ll use powerful pumps and wet vacuums to remove the water quickly and efficiently. This step is critical in preventing further damage and ensuring a successful restoration process.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
After the water is extracted, our team will use specialized equipment to dry and dehumidify the affected area. We’ll use industrial-strength fans and dehumidifiers to speed up the drying process. This step is crucial in preventing mold growth and ensuring a successful restoration process.
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ing
Once the area is dry, our team will clean and sanitize the affected area to prevent mold growth and bacterial contamination. We’ll use specialized cleaning solutions and equipment to ensure a thorough clean. This step is critical in preventing further damage and ensuring a successful restoration process.
Step 5: Final Inspection and Repair
After the cleaning and sanitizing process is complete, our team will conduct a final inspection to ensure that the affected area is completely dry and free of any further damage.
